Net Worth Context and Why It Is Not the Same as Annual Earnings

Net worth reflects lifetime accumulation of assets and liabilities, while annual earnings reflect income received in a given year. For top comedians, net worth is shaped by touring history, television and film roles, product lines, and long-term residuals. Earnings for 2024 are best understood as a flow measure rather than a stock measure. This article focuses on annual earnings because the question explicitly asks about who earned the most in a specific year.

Primary Income Streams That Drive High Earnings for Comedians

Comedians can generate revenue through several key channels. The most significant drivers for top-earning comedians in 2024 included:

  • Live touring and ticket sales, often supported by tiered pricing and premium experiences
  • Streaming specials on major platforms and backend revenue from viewership
  • Television appearances, hosting roles, and cameo or scripted work
  • Brand endorsements, partnerships, and behind-the-scenes content
  • Residuals and licensing from existing filmed material

These streams can compound; for example, a successful tour can raise the value of subsequent streaming specials and endorsement deals, creating a positive earnings feedback loop.

Common Misconceptions and Status Clarifications

It is sometimes assumed that net worth alone indicates who earned the most in a given year, but this is not accurate. Past earnings, real estate holdings, and long-term investments can inflate net worth without reflecting current-year income. Another misconception is that streaming alone can produce the highest annual earnings; in practice, the largest totals come from a combination of live performance and media leverage. This status clarification helps separate durable career achievements from single-year anomalies.
